Police arrest two suspected cultists in Awka, recover one gun, 16 cartridges

Security

Police in Anambra State have arrested two persons suspected to be cultists and also participating activities of armed robbers.

Spokesperson for Anambra State police command, SP Tochukwu Ikenga said the arrest followed recent complaints about theft of phones by robbers at the popular Club Street in Awka.

He said as a result of these complaints, the Commissioner of Police, CP Ikioye Orutugu rose to nip the occurrences in the bud.

Ikenga said: “Innocent road users along Club Road, Awka, popularly known as Abakiliki Street, are regularly robbed of their phones.

“Because of this, Police Operatives attached to the Special Anti-cult Unit Enugwu Ukwu visited the area in the early hours of 18th March, 2025, and arrested one Chibuike Ozoekwem ‘M’ 22 years and Favour Patrick ‘F’ 19 years respectively.”

He said both were trailed and arrested in an uncompleted building at Onwurah Street, Awka.

“The Operatives recovered one pump action gun, sixteen (16) pieces of expended cartridges, a battle Axe, and two suspected stolen phones.

“Subsequently, a victim identified one of the recovered phones and stated that she was robbed on the 13th of March, 2025 at gun point by four armed men along the Club Road.

“The Police Operatives have expanded the investigation aimed at arresting other gang members. Further details would be communicated on receipt.”

He added that all the suspects would be charged to court on the conclusion of investigations into the matter.
